RedMagic Gaming Tablet 5 Pro launched in China
Specifications
Display:
📱 9.06" BOE X10 2.4K 185Hz OLED Display, 1600nits Peak Brightness, 110nits HBM, 5280Hz PWM Dimming
Performance:
⚡️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en5
⚡️ RedCore R4 Chip
⚡️ LPDDR5X (10667Mbps)
⚡️ UFS 4.1 (4200MB/s)
Camera:
📸 13MP OV13B10 Rear
🤳 9MP OV08X40 Front
Battery and charging:
🔋 8300mAh battery
🔌 80W charging
Software and extra:
⚙️ REDMAGIC OS 11.5
💠 Synaptics S3930 Touch Chip, 2000Hz Instantaneous TSR
✨️ Dual USB Type-C port / USB 3.2 Gen2 & USB 2.0, Bypass Charging Pro
💠 Side-Mounted Fingerprint, Dual 0815 X-axis Linear Motor, Dual 1227 Speakers
✨️ Built-in PC Emulator with Steam Direct Connection
❄️ Water Cooling & Built-in Cooling Fan
❄️ Water-Cooled RGB Heat Dissipation Technology / RGB Lighting
📶 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 5.3, NFC
📏 6.9mm
⚖️ 363g
Price:
🏷 5299¥ ~ 12+256GB

Software and security support for Samsung
Galaxy S25 series -7 years Android OS 7 year security
Galaxy S24 series - 7 years Android OS and 7 year security
Galaxy S23 series - 4 years Android OS and 5 year security
Galaxy S22 series - 4 years Android OS and 5 year security updates
Galaxy S21 series - 4 years Android OS and 5 year security updates
Galaxy S20 series - 3 years Android OS and 4 year security updates
Galaxy A14 series - 2 years Android OS and 4 year security updates
Samsung galaxy A,F,M06 5G - 4 years Android OS and 4 year security updates
Galaxy A15 series - 4 years Android OS and 5 year security
Galaxy A07 , A16 and above this year A,M,F series - 6 years Android OS and 6 year security
Samsung galaxy A33 and above - 4 years of Android OS and 5 years of security
Galaxy Tab S10 series - 7 years of Android OS and 7 years of security
Galaxy Tab S9 series - 4 years of Android OS and 5 years of security
Galaxy Tab S11 series - 7 years of Android OS and 7 years of security
Galaxy Tab A11 series - 7 years of Android OS and 7 years of security
Samsung galaxy M35 , Galaxy M34 and Galaxy M54,above too - 4 years of Android OS and 5 years of security
( same in a series rebrand m,f

Btw on February 9 2022 - Samsung Announces 4 Generations of OneUI (Android OS) and 5 Years of Security Updates for selected Galaxy Devices
- Galaxy S22, S22+, S22 Ultra, Galaxy S21 Series (S21,S21+,S21U,S21 FE)
- Galaxy Z Fold3, Z Flip3
- Selected Upcoming Galaxy A Series
- Tab S8, S8+, S8 Ultra
On 20 September 2024 - Samsung announced
7 years of updates for TVs
7 years of updates for flagship phones
7 years of updates for flagship tablets
6 years of updates for the Galaxy A series

Why can’t non-Chinese companies compete with the Chinese?
The main reason is supply chain control.
Almost every big innovation you see in Chinese phones, like silicon batteries, tri-fold designs, or other new features, comes from their tight control over the supply chain. This lets them build and launch new tech faster than others.
For example, this year Qualcomm and MediaTek released their chips early so that Chinese brands could launch new phones before the Chinese New Year, giving them a big sales lead.
So, can non-Chinese brands or new companies compete with them?
Yes, but not in hardware.
In the future, as supply chains become more global and less dependent on China, the real competition will shift to software and AI features.
The smartphone race is slowly moving from hardware to software, and that is where the next big battles will happen.

A Japanese capsule toy company is making tiny PC parts that you can collect and build.
Tarlin has teamed up with ASRock, Gigabyte, MSI, and Intel to create small, realistic PC components that fit together like a real desktop PC.

The first collection includes:
- Three different motherboards from ASRock, Gigabyte, and MSI
- An Intel Core Ultra 7 processor
- A PC case
- A power supply
- Case fans
The parts are not just for display. You can assemble them to build a miniature PC, making them more fun than regular capsule toys.
Tarlin is already known in Japan for making detailed miniature tech collectibles, and this is its latest project.

WhatsApp Username Feature may soon Blocked in India - Government is Eyeing the Legality Side
After WhatsApp announced the rollout of its Instagram-like “username feature”, the Indian government raised concerns regarding impersonation.

- The Indian government is examining WhatsApp's username feature over impersonation and identity fraud concerns.
- Authorities are exploring legal options and may issue a notice to Meta if the feature is found to pose risks.
- Officials will assess whether stronger safeguards are needed before the feature is rolled out in India.
- WhatsApp says usernames are meant to improve privacy by letting users connect without sharing phone numbers.
- The Indian government has issued a notice to Meta and sought a detailed reply within 3 days
- Meta has been directed not to roll out WhatsApp's username feature in India until consultations are completed
- The move follows concerns that usernames could increase impersonation, fraud and cybersecurity risks.

China Pricing vs India Pricing of Smartphones
Chinese phone prices are always lower compared to India and even globally, no other country matches them

Why China Gets Cheaper Phones
1) China has the entire global supply chain
They have full control, access to components early, and can stockpile the latest hardware months before it launches globally
This allows brands to build phones faster and at far lower cost
2) Chinese phones inside China are heavily subsidised.Market Size Difference
Because they rely on their own apps, services, ads, and ecosystems, brands earn extra revenue
Outside China in markets like India, Android phones depend on Google services, so brands cannot use the same subsidy model
As a result, phones in China are sold cheaper to boost ecosystem lock-in
The Chinese smartphone market is massive and brands sell extremely high volumes
These huge volumes let them keep prices lower, which is not possible in India
Why Phones Are Costlier in India Now
India’s smartphone market is already saturated and growing very slowly
Companies are struggling to sell big volumes like before
So brands follow a new strategy:
Sell fewer phones, but at a higher price to maintain profit
But here is the real problem:
Consumer income is not rising
So fewer people are buying expensive new phones
EMI Trend
Nearly 1 out of 3 phones in India is bought on EMI
But interest rates are rising fast
This affects Tier 2 and Tier 3 cities the most, leading to an overall market slowdown
Let's see how brands adapt in 2026
Either they correct prices or the slowdown will get worse.
